Operating the Camera From Your Computer
Follow these steps to take pictures from your computer:

4
Start Image Expert as described on page 8-6.
5
If necessary, close the Quick Tour and the Image Expert
tip screen.
6
Click the
Camera Controls
button
or choose
Controls
from the Camera menu.
You see a dialog box like the following:
7
Click
Continuous Update
to activate the live preview
feature. The image you see is updated every 8 to 10
seconds, depending on your connection speed. You may
need to move the camera or your subject until you see
the image you want to capture.
The colors in your live preview image may appear pale
and washed-out. This will not affect the colors in your
actual photograph.
